Visa Options for British Citizens
British citizens have a couple of options when it comes to obtaining a visa for Egypt. The most common method is the e-Visa, which simplifies the application process significantly. The e-Visa can be applied for online and is typically valid for tourism purposes, allowing stays of up to 30 days. The application process is straightforward; all you need to do is fill out an online form, upload a passport-sized photo, and pay the required fee. Once approved, the e-Visa is sent to your email, and you simply print it out to present upon arrival in Egypt. Egypt Visa For BRITISH CITIZENS.
Another option for British citizens is the traditional visa obtained from an Egyptian embassy or consulate prior to travel. This route may be preferred by those who wish to stay longer than 30 days or have specific travel purposes, such as work or study. The application involves submitting a form, along with supporting documents, including proof of accommodation and travel itinerary. Although this method requires more effort and time, it provides flexibility for longer stays.

Visa Options for US Citizens
US citizens traveling to Egypt also have several visa options available. Similar to British travelers, US citizens can choose to apply for an e-Visa, which is a convenient solution for those looking to visit Egypt for tourism. The process mirrors that of the British e-Visa application, allowing stays of up to 30 days. The e-Visa is particularly beneficial for last-minute travelers, as the process can usually be completed within a few days. Egypt Visa For US CITIZENS.
Alternatively, US citizens can opt for a visa on arrival, which is available at various airports in Egypt. This option is suitable for those who prefer not to deal with the online application process. Upon arrival, travelers can obtain a visa valid for 30 days by paying the visa fee. However, it’s advisable to carry the exact amount in cash to avoid complications. The visa on arrival is an excellent choice for spontaneous trips, but travelers should be aware that it may involve longer waits at the airport.
For longer stays or specific purposes such as business, study, or work, US citizens will need to apply for a visa through an Egyptian embassy or consulate. Similar to the process for British citizens, this involves submitting an application form along with supporting documents. This method can be more time-consuming but offers the necessary visa type for various travel purposes.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How much does it cost to obtain an e-Visa for Egypt?
The cost of the e-Visa for Egypt varies depending on the type of visa you apply for. Typically, a single-entry tourist e-Visa costs around $25 for US citizens and about £25 for British citizens. Additional fees may apply if you choose expedited processing.
2. How long is the e-Visa valid for?
The e-Visa is generally valid for 30 days from the date of entry into Egypt. Travelers should ensure their stay does not exceed this duration unless they have obtained the appropriate visa for longer stays.
3. Can I extend my visa while in Egypt?
Yes, it is possible to extend your visa while in Egypt. However, this process must be done through the Egyptian immigration authorities, and it is advisable to start the extension process at least a week before your visa expires.
